Other Information

**Key characteristics:** - Gene name: FLOT2 - Ensembl ID: ENSG00000132589 - Protein name: Flotillin-2 - Protein type: transmembrane protein - Expression: Highly expressed in various cell types in the human body - Function: Involved in cell adhesion, epidermal development, negative regulation of gene expression, neuronal system, programmed cell death, protein-protein interactions at synapses, protein binding, and signaling by rho gtpases **Pathways and functions:** - Cell adhesion: Flotillin-2 is expressed on the surface of epithelial cells and immune cells, where it plays a role in cell adhesion. - Epidermis development: Flotillin-2 is expressed in the skin and is involved in the development of the epidermis. - Negative regulation of gene expression: Flotillin-2 is a negative regulator of gene expression, and it has been shown to be involved in the regulation of skin development. - Neuronal system: Flotillin-2 is expressed in neurons and plays a role in neuronal development and function. - Programmed cell death: Flotillin-2 is involved in programmed cell death, a process known as apoptosis. - Protein-protein interactions at synapses: Flotillin-2 is involved in protein-protein interactions at synapses, which are essential for synaptic plasticity and learning and memory. - Protein binding: Flotillin-2 can bind to various proteins, including cadherins, integrins, and tetraspanins. These interactions are involved in cell adhesion, cell signaling, and tissue organization. - Signal transduction: Flotillin-2 is a substrate for several rho GTPases, including Rhoa, Rhob, and Rhoc. These GTPases are involved in various cellular processes, including cell adhesion, migration, and differentiation. **Clinical significance:** - Dysregulation of FLOT2 has been linked to various diseases, including cancer, autoimmune disorders, and neurodegenerative diseases. - In cancer, FLOT2 is overexpressed on tumor cells, where it promotes cell adhesion, migration, and invasion. - In autoimmune disorders, FLOT2 is expressed on immune cells and may contribute to the inflammatory response. - In neurodegenerative diseases, FLOT2 is involved in neuronal survival and differentiation.
